Frequently Asked Questions
Botox is approved for chronic migraine, which means having 15 or more headache days per month. A headache specialist will review your history and previous treatments to determine eligibility.
Botox for migraine is typically administered every 12 weeks. Consistent treatment is important to maintain preventive benefits.
Some patients notice improvement after the first treatment cycle, while others see gradual benefits after the second or third session.
The injections use very small needles and are generally well tolerated. Most patients describe the discomfort as brief and mild.
Many insurance plans cover Botox for chronic migraine when medical criteria are met. Coverage is reviewed during the consultation process.
